MSC Cruises has grown exponentially since 2003. In such a short time, we have built a fleet of 22 modern and most environmentally advanced ships!
With our constant expansion, our fleet will grow in capacity with the arrival of seven new ships in three different classes by 2027.
One of our latest ships – MSC World Europa – was delivered in 2022, inaugurating the World Class. It is our largest cruise ship to date, with a capacity of over 6,700 passengers, served by more than 2,000 crew members.
In 2023 we inaugurated the MSC Euribia equipped with the best and latest environmental technology and bestowed with a highly-innovative design.
In 2023 MSC Cruises entered the Luxury segment by launching its first of four Explora Journeys ships.
